>is that for the original cube or the later PC version of NeXTstep?
It is for the original (motorola68004processor) NeXT:
on the Intel platform , the NeXT midi driver A.P.I. changed extensively,
and I (or anybody else) have not taken enough time to fix the Midi 
code in csound to be compliant with the new midi libs on Intel. 

>Since Rhapsody runs native Mac binaries in addition to NeXTstep
I know some Rhapsody developers: perhaps we can get a compilation going
on their box. Yes: there will be O.S. emulation for Mac and old NeXT binaries.
I cannot recommend using such with Csound: I imagine the emulation 
overhead would be greatly noticable. I will get an "Original NeXT" binary
built for 3.47 soon, and upload it. But what really needs to be done is
